| Makes: | 12 servings |
| Prep Time: | 40 minutes |
| Cook Time: | 1 hour, 0 minutes |
| Ready In: | 1 hour, 40 minutes |
|
As a young mother, I was given this recipe. It is truly wonderful. |
| |
| Ingredients |
| 1 1/2 cup sugar |
2 cups flour |
| 2 eggs |
1 large can fruit cocktail with liquid |
| 1 tsp vanilla |
2 tsp baking soda |
| 1/2 tsp salt |
1/2 cup brown sugar |
| 1/2 cup pecans |
Icing |
| 1 stick oleo, margarine or butter |
3/4 cup sugar |
| 1/2 can canned evaporated milk |
1/2 cup pecans |
|
| | | Directions | Cake: In a large mixing bowl, mix the sugar, flour, eggs, vanilla, soda, salt, and the fruit cocktail. Pour into a greased and floured sheet pan. Top with brown sugar and pecans. Bake at 350 degrees for 1 hour.
Icing: In a sauce pan combine the margarine, sugar and canned milk and cook for 2 minutes. Add the 1/2 cup pecans. Let it turn stiff and spread over cooled cake.
